Production process
Permanent metallic magnets are typically produced through a process called sintering. This involves compacting metal powders, such as neodymium, samarium, or alnico, into the desired shape and then heating them to high temperatures to fuse the particles together. The resulting magnets are then magnetized, coated, and finished to meet specific performance and durability requirements.
Production inputs
The production of permanent metallic magnets requires a range of raw materials, including rare earth metals, transition metals, and various alloys. Additionally, specialized machinery, such as powder compaction presses and sintering furnaces, are essential for the manufacturing process. Energy, labor, and quality control systems are also important inputs for this industry.
